Some cars which I revisit in GT6 are such no brainers to come back in Gran Turismo that it really does seem flabbergasting. The C5 Corvette for example, or more recently the Mitsubishi Evo IX which we of course finally have back thanks to a GT7 update. The DC5 Integra Type R is another, a car which is so iconic in the modern JDM scene that it seems stranger than strange to not already have it in the game, especially with the even more iconic DC2 Integra already being added previously...
''Unlike the Type R models before it, the 2001 Honda Integra Type R was an all-new machine engineered from the ground up, as opposed to a spiced up version of an existing model that comprised of a stiffer suspension and new body kit. As a result, Honda engineers were very thorough in endowing the car with a high degree of performance and refinement, but not at the expense of everyday driving comfort.
For example, sound insulation was taken out to save weight, but the engineers made a concerted effort to reduce noise and vibration to the absolute minimum to secure a high level of comfort. That said, the driving performance of this Type R was greatly improved over its predecessors. This was thanks mainly to what sat under the hood: a revised K20A motor that was a 2.0-liter DOHC inline-4 with i-VTEC that pumped out 217 HP and 151.8 ft-lb of torque.
It featured a lightweight flywheel for improved throttle response and was mated to a close-ratio 6-speed manual gearbox with multi-cone synchro gears. The suspension employed struts up front and double wishbones at the rear, while the brakes were supplied by Brembo, making this Type R the first Honda equipped with factory Brembos.
The Honda Integra Type R could arguably have been the best handling FF (Front engine, Front drive) sports coupe in the world in its day. Sadly, the car's lifespan was a short one. Facing declining coupe sales in Japan, the Type R ceased production in July 2006.''
